Output ec45cac27816c5fe6b00e411580c3b4d7d051a8510c8fc8f4eef1cee42bca2ea:856

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0bafc88bda0abe72cce897319f83fd5d340792959ad7d86e9f170a433a839878
address
tb1ppwhu3z76p2l89n8gjucelqlat56q0y54nttasm5lzu9yxw5rnpuqhwyngy
transaction
ec45cac27816c5fe6b00e411580c3b4d7d051a8510c8fc8f4eef1cee42bca2ea